Q: How often should I clean the camera’s sensor?
A: It depends on usage, but it is recommended to clean the sensor every 6-12 months.

Q: Can I use other lenses with the D7200?
A: Yes, the D7200 is compatible with all Nikon F-mount lenses.

Q: How can I extend the life of my camera’s battery?
A: Use power-saving modes, turn off the camera when not in use, and avoid extreme temperatures.
